Course Content

• Energy Audits and Retro-Commissioning for Retail Spaces
• HVAC Systems Optimization and Energy Efficiency in Retail
• Lighting Technologies and Energy-Efficient Illumination Strategies for Retailers
• Refrigeration Systems for Retail: Energy Management and Best Practices
• Building Envelope Improvements for Retail Energy Conservation
• Demand Response Programs and Peak Load Reduction for Retail Businesses
• Data Analytics and Energy Monitoring for Retail Energy Management
• Renewable Energy Integration in Retail Facilities (Solar, Wind)
• Energy Conservation Legislation and Compliance for Retailers
• Financial Incentives and Funding Opportunities for Retail Energy Efficiency Projects

Role Description
Energy Efficiency Consultant (Retail) Conduct energy audits, identify improvement areas, and implement energy-saving strategies in retail environments. Focus on reducing carbon footprint and operational costs.
Sustainability Manager (Retail) Develop and implement sustainable practices across retail operations, including energy conservation, waste reduction, and ethical sourcing. A leadership role driving corporate social responsibility.
Energy Procurement Specialist (Retail) Negotiate energy contracts, secure cost-effective energy solutions, and manage energy supply for retail chains, focusing on renewable energy sources.
